The positive pressure cabinet matches the intelligent control system inside the explosion-proof control box with the pressure control system to introduce clean and safe compressed air into the positive pressure chamber, creating a slight positive pressure inside the chamber and preventing the entry of hazardous gases and dust from the outside, achieving the purpose of explosion prevention. This product has functions such as intelligent centralized control, LCD text display, automatic ventilation, delayed automatic power supply, pressure relief, fault alarm, and automatic power-off in case of danger.

Structural Overview

The positive pressure cabinet consists of a positive pressure chamber and a control chamber. The positive pressure chamber is used to install various non explosion proof instruments or electrical appliances, while the control chamber consists of an explosion-proof control box and a pressure control system. The outer shell of the positive pressure cabinet is welded with 2-3mm cold-rolled steel plates, the ventilation pipes are made of galvanized steel pipes, and the incoming and outgoing cables are connected with conduit joints and cable entry clamping devices. The front door is equipped with a glass display window, which displays instruments and indicator lights. .

safety indicators

a、 Automatic exhaust when the positive pressure value inside the cabinet is greater than 280Pa

b、 When the positive pressure value inside the cabinet is less than 80Pa and greater than 50Pa, an automatic alarm will be triggered

C、 If the positive pressure value inside the cabinet is less than 50Pa, the power will be automatically cut off

working principle

The working principle of the positive pressure cabinet is shown in the left figure. After the external 220 volt current is introduced into the explosion-proof control box, the "start button" is pressed, and the electromagnetic threshold 4 is excited to open the intake pipeline. Compressed air is filtered and depressurized before entering the positive pressure chamber. The dangerous gas in the positive pressure chamber is discharged from the positive pressure chamber through exhaust. When the dangerous gas in the positive pressure chamber is replaced to safety, the ventilation is completed and the interlocking contacts are automatically closed. At this time, the electrical appliances and instruments in the positive pressure chamber can work.

Adjustment of positive pressure value

Adjust the handle for adjusting the positive pressure value at the lower end of the one-way throttle, turn it clockwise to increase the positive pressure value, and vice versa to decrease the positive pressure value. It is advisable to adjust the positive pressure value to 250Pa. If the pressure is too low to be adjusted to this pressure, check whether the intake is fully open and whether the positive pressure chamber is sealed from the outside.

Interlocking function selection

When the positive pressure cabinet is used in hazardous areas in Zone 1, if the positive pressure value is less than 50Pa, the interlocking contact must be disconnected; If used in hazardous areas in Zone 2, if the positive pressure value is less than 50Pa, the interlocking contacts can be continuously opened; But it is necessary to handle it in a timely manner to ensure that the pressure is greater than 50Pa. This function is adjusted by the third position of the shift switch U2. The third position is disconnected at the upper lock contact and continuously opens at the lower lock contact. When shifting, it needs to be done in the disconnected state.

Positive pressure explosion-proofCabinet constant temperature cooling system

Adopting water cooling method, the cooling water is automatically controlled to enter the internal air conditioning heat exchanger of the system, taking away the heat inside the positive pressure cabinet, ensuring that the internal of the positive pressure system is in a constant temperature state, and ensuring the safety of internal components.
